Output 26aa085c28373c048c0cb183187b6fb44ff453ec913b52c6c34a9b581abd7074:16

value
6574000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a8f6ff66794a1d6da003c8c66d9b8967a3ec6921 OP_EQUAL
address
3H6RLUBC7zAsCTtmbAtefRDaHUsbVvNzaq
transaction
26aa085c28373c048c0cb183187b6fb44ff453ec913b52c6c34a9b581abd7074
spent
true